sFeatures

Extremely light weight

The largest version, with all contacts loaded, weights only 0.11gramms.

Conductive traces on the PCB can run under the connector

No exposed contacts on the bottom of the connector.

High density together with reliable solderability on the board

Staggered contact points and the leads plus the nickel barriers assure sufficient distance to prevents solder bridging.

Easy FPC insertion and reliable electrical connection

Proven Flip actuator allows easy insertion of FPC. Tactile sensation when fully closed confirms complete electrical and mechanical connection.

Accepts standard thickness FPC
mm thick standard Flexible Printed Circuit board can be used. This is the only ultra-low profile ZIF connector allowing the use of standard FPC.

Board placement with automatic equipment

Flat top surface and packaging on the tape-and-reel allows use of vacuum nozzles. Standard reel contains 5,000 connectors.
sApplications

Mobile phones, PDA’s, digital cameras, digital video cameras, LCD connections, plasma displays PDP , camera modules and other compact devices requiring Flexible Printed Circuit connections using high reliability ultra-small profile connectors.

No exposed contacts Metal fittings do not protrude outside of the connector body

Absence of protrusions on each side of connector allows closer side-by-side mounting of the connectors or closer component placement in miniaturized devices.

sProduct Specifications

Rating

Rated current A DC Rated voltage 30 V AC

Operating temperature range -55ç to +85ç Note 1 Operating humidity range Relative humidity 90% max. No condensation

Storage temperature range -10ç to +50ç Note 2 Storage humidity range Relative humidity 90% max.

Recommended FPC Thickness = 0.2±0.03mm thick, gold plated connecting traces

sOrdering information

FH25- 51S - - SH 05
1 Series name FH25 2 No. of contacts

Number of contacts 21, 27, 33, 39, 45, 51
3 Contact pitch mm
4 Terminal type

SH SMT horizontal mounting type
5 Plating specifications
05 Gold, selective flash plated
